Transaction 676e7224dc18bec1cd2d98a8ccd0e2dcf146a6cdaff3cbfd2405896911e5503d
1 Input
1 Output
-
676e7224dc18bec1cd2d98a8ccd0e2dcf146a6cdaff3cbfd2405896911e5503d:0
- value
- 300936332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bc9768bcab34a477c8a620b6f9e38df427bb27e OP_EQUAL
- address
- 3A4Lku9PsJ3tWtWVY7xhbmVuRzXFX7nGur